In this episode on the Living with Alzheimer's podcast, Christoph interviews Nicole Brackett, Director of Care Delivery and Quality for Homewatch CareGivers. They discuss the many services Homewatch CareGivers provides to families, especially those caring for a family member with dementia. Nicole describes the importance of personalized care plans, as well as the culture-shift her organization is embracing by focusing on the person and not their disability. Nicole and Christoph discuss examples of a person-centered approach to care partnerships.They go on to discuss how families can distinguish between care that can be provided in the individual's home, and when a care community may be the better fit. And Nicole outlines the Five Rs of Caregiving (Remain calm, Respond to feelings, Reassure, Remove yourself to gain composure, and Return fully when the person you're caring for has calmed) to help caregivers sustain quality care without burning out.The episode wraps up with conversation about a free resource for caregivers, called Pathways To Well-Being With Dementia from Dementia Action Alliance, as well as a caregiver certification program that Homewatch CareGivers is developing with Dr. Al Power.

Recession-Proof and Evergreen, Is Home Health Caregiving Right for You? with Jamie Lavigne, Homewatch CareGivers

She Turned Entrepreneur

Play Episode Listen Later Mar 18, 2022 16:34


This episode of She Turned Entrepreneur features a franchise niche that is as inelastic as they come: Home Healthcare. Jamie Lavigne, franchise development manager for Homewatch CareGivers, walks us through the model and what makes for an ideal business owner. It's an industry unlike any other, given the level of trust, intimacy and adaptability required. The work may not always be easy, says Jamie, but it's always meaningful. Homewatch CareGiver franchises have recently seen a 11% increase in business year over year, not only because of Covid impacts but also as the result of an aging population. And because this is not strictly an elder care business, the customer base also includes post-operative patients of all ages as well as people with mental disabilities or mobility challenges. Homewatch's heavy emphasis on training fosters retention and provides resources that enable aids to focus on their true mission – caregiving – which, as Jamie points out, is not a skill that can be taught. It's the passion and generosity of spirit that should be central to anyone who enters this fulfilling, but challenging space. Jamie walks us through the business model, what the franchise provides in terms of ongoing support, the biggest obstacles and most desirable skills for would-be owners. The model offers engagement in either or both of two capacities: As an outward-facing community resource manager or, for those who prefer to stick closer to the back office, as an operations manager. Jamie shares the skill sets required and explains the differentiators that prepare Homewatch franchisees for long-term support while riding a tidal wave of demand. The franchise owner's biggest challenge is hiring and retaining staff who understand the mission and are ready to embrace Homewatch's gold-standard training. Put the right team in place, says Jamie, and get ready for exponential growth. Here are key takeaways from the conversation:· Homewatch CareGivers grew slowly and methodically over many years before moving to a national franchise model.· A huge challenge within the home health caregiving industry is retention, which Homewatch addresses through extensive and ongoing training/support.· Recipe for Success: Providing support first and foremost to franchise employees, who represent the business and build relationships.· Homewatch franchise all-in costs vary in part based on size of territory and local tax/insurance rates.· Home health care is recession-proof and ecommerce-proof, especially as the population ages and needs become more acute nationwide.· Home health care isn't always easy, but it is always rewarding! Here's a quick look into the episode:· Jamie shares the “origin story” for Homewatch CareGivers, founded by a military veteran in 1974 as a pet sitting business that quickly morphed into general caregiving and,16 years later, into a franchise model that eventually went nationwide.· Today Homewatch is part of Authority Brands, which is an umbrella for a total of 12 franchises.· A day in the life of a Homewatch franchisee can involve either or both of two roles:o A Community outreach coordinator, who is constantly building relationships within the community at three major levels:§ Healthcare continuum: Identifying the best local medical resources.§ Ancillary businesses: Repair, home maintenance and other support.§ Brand ambassador, making home visits and building general trust and respect within the community at large.o An operations manager, who on a day-to-day basis is:§ Answering/returning calls.§ Scheduling visits.§ Recruiting and retaining qualified home health care staff.· Jamie explains Homewatch's primary differentiators, which are primarily inhouse: o It's among the oldest, most established brands nationally.o Care to Stay: A program that Homewatch has instituted to support franchisees in promoting all-important caregiver staffing and retention. § The program boosts retention to 30-40% (well above the average in the home health care business).§ Homewatch supports 12 hours of ongoing training and development each year, including access to 2400 Homewatch Care University courses.§ Operational training for franchisees that extends a full year.· What Homewatch looks for in ideal franchise owners:o #1 hands down: Passion for people.o Ability to problem-solve on the fly.o Leadership skills.o Sales ability is a big plus.o Solid financials: at least $80,000 liquid and net worth of about $350,000.· About the franchise fee: $49,500. Overall cost ranges from $92,000-$164,000, depending on the size of territory and insurance/tax rates locally. · Rounded up, Jamie suggests prospective owners be prepared to float a $200,000 worst-case-scenario investment if it doesn't take off like a rocket ship. · Home health care is resilient as far as recession and economic trends. It's also fairly simple: Managing caregivers and clients. · It's not always easy, but extremely scalable and rewarding.

Since joining HomeWatch Caregivers in 2015, Julie Smith has led the company from being family-owned to being in private equity ownership, through transactions that set industry records for their multiples. Today, HomeWatch Caregivers is leveraging the PE capital to expand its footprint, and it is also bolstering its technology platform to drive care coordination and other efforts --- all of which are making the company into a true disruptor, Smith believes. She is bullish on Medicare Advantage, but also has concerns about how to better match up the franchise-based home care model with the needs of increasing care coordination with different types of payers and providers.
